Output cc66b68b9410348530082a861c456972e808fc8cf070dd2d90364e957c798bd3:2

value
130664
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49f00e353f0b2663b380547ae116fb9498aef53e OP_EQUALVERIFY OP_CHECKSIG
address
17jwuMRh69LW43utSNi4JffskjVHn82unL
transaction
cc66b68b9410348530082a861c456972e808fc8cf070dd2d90364e957c798bd3
spent
true